mcp-server-typescript
by dataforseo·★ 198·综合分 49
一个为DataForSEO API设计的全面MCP服务器,提供SEO数据、关键词研究、SERP跟踪和域名分析。
概述
此MCP服务器连接AI助手和DataForSEO强大的SEO API,提供包括AI优化、SERP跟踪、关键词数据、页面分析、反向链接分析在内的九个不同模块。该实现基于TypeScript架构,具有全面的错误处理、可配置模块,支持直接MCP通信和HTTP传输,还支持Cloudflare Worker部署以实现边缘访问。
试试问 AI
装完之后,这里有 5 个你可以让 AI 做的事:
什么时候选它
当你需要通过 AI 助手访问全面的 SEO 数据,并且已经拥有或愿意设置 DataForSEO API 凭据时,选择此 MCP 服务器。
什么时候不要选它
如果你需要免费的 SEO 数据访问(需要付费的 DataForSEO 订阅)或需要与非 SEO API 集成,请避免使用此服务器。
此 server 暴露的工具
从 README 抽取出 9 个工具ai_optimizationProvides data for keyword discovery, conversational optimization, and real-time LLM benchmarking
serpGet real-time Search Engine Results Page data for Google, Bing, and Yahoo
keywords_dataKeyword research and clickstream data including search volume and CPC metrics
onpageCrawl websites to obtain on-page SEO performance metrics
dataforseo_labsGet data on keywords, SERPs, and domains from DataForSEO's proprietary databases
backlinksComprehensive backlink analysis including referring domains and anchor text distribution
business_dataPublicly available data on any business entity
domain_analyticsData on website traffic, technologies, and Whois details
content_analysisBrand monitoring, sentiment analysis, and citation management
可对比工具
安装
安装
- 全局安装:
npm install -g dataforseo-mcp-server- 直接运行:
npx dataforseo-mcp-server- 设置环境变量:
export DATAFORSEO_USERNAME=your_username
export DATAFORSEO_PASSWORD=your_password- 对于Claude Desktop,添加到config.json:
{
"mcpServers": {
"DataForSEO": {
"command": "npx",
"args": ["dataforseo-mcp-server"]
}
}
}FAQ
- 支持哪些认证方法?
- 服务器支持基本认证和环境变量认证。使用HTTP传输时,可以通过基本认证头或环境变量提供凭据。
- 如何启用特定模块?
- 设置ENABLED_MODULES环境变量,用逗号分隔模块名称(如SERP,KEYWORDS_DATA)。如果未设置,将启用所有模块。
mcp-server-typescript 对比
最后更新于 · 由 README + GitHub 公开数据自动生成。